kcms/rules: show explanatory text with contextual help button, not tooltip
Tooltips don't work when using the system with touch, and these here are also a bit annoying with a pointing device since they appear instantly on hover and take up a lot of space, so they unexpectedly pop up and cover UI elements a lot. To improve this, use a KCM.ContextualHelpButton inline in the list items to show the explanation when clicked or hovered, just like we do in most other places in other KCMs. To make this work, the internal line breaks in the explanatory text had to be removed to make the text flow properly with an arbitrarily-sized tooltip.
Please register or sign in to comment